Crown Products Limited Overview
Crown Products Limited is a live company located in chesterfield, S41 9RQ with a Companies House number of 01349378. It operates in the printing n.e.c. sector, SIC Code 18129. Founded in January 1978, it's largest shareholder is r.a. parsons with a 100% stake. Crown Products Limited is a mature, small s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£2m with healthy growth in recent years.
